Product

Icon

Contract dining programs

Aramark designs and operates on-site contract dining across 19 countries, tailoring daypart-specific programs to client populations and serving millions daily. Menus emphasize variety, nutrition and regional preferences with consistent quality standards. Modular concepts enable rapid rotation and seasonal refreshes. Back-of-house systems uphold food safety, enforce portion control and drive measurable waste reduction.

Icon

Catering and event services

Full-service catering covers meetings, conferences and premium events across sectors, with Aramark reporting $17.6 billion in revenue for FY2024 and operations in 19 countries supporting thousands of events annually. Scalable teams enable menu customization, elevated presentation and VIP hospitality. Logistics and staffing flex to peak demand windows with rapid redeployment. Post-event analytics feed planning and cost control, improving margin and forecasting.

Comprehensive facilities management

Comprehensive facilities management bundles integrated hard and soft services—maintenance, cleaning, grounds and energy—delivered by Aramark across 19 countries with ~220,000 employees. Predictive maintenance and computerized work-order systems boost uptime and speed resolution. Safety, compliance and infection-control protocols are embedded into operations. Service-level standards are mapped to client KPIs and accreditation requirements.

Icon

Uniforms and workwear solutions

Aramark delivers end-to-end supply, role-specific garment programs, onsite laundering and timed replacement of uniforms and PPE, aligning service cadence with shift patterns and OSHA 29 CFR 1910 requirements.

Inventory tracking and RFID-enabled programs support right-sizing and loss prevention; global uniform rental market was valued at about $10.9B in 2023 (Grand View Research), underscoring scale and demand.

    Experience and wellness enhancements

    Experience and wellness enhancements lift employee, student, patient, and fan satisfaction through targeted programs including nutrition counseling, allergen management, and customizable patient dining; Aramark operates in 19 countries and reported FY2023 revenue of $16.2 billion. Themed fan and campus concepts plus speed-of-service tech shorten dwell time and feedback loops enable iterative improvements across touchpoints.

    Place

    Icon

    On-site service delivery

    Aramark delivers services on-site across campuses, hospitals, corporate sites and venues, leveraging embedded teams for real-time responsiveness. Site-specific layouts and flow optimization reduce dwell times and improve operational efficiency. Local leadership in each of Aramark’s operations across 19 countries and ~280,000 employees ensures accountability and stakeholder alignment.

    Icon

    Regional operations network

    Decentralized regional hubs support recruiting, training and oversight across Aramark’s 19-country network and roughly 280,000 employees, ensuring local talent pipelines. Field managers benchmark performance across sites and rapidly share best practices and resources. Proximity reduces response times and supports consistent execution.

    Supply chain and vendor partnerships

    Aramark balances national scale with local suppliers to preserve freshness and community impact while supporting operations across 19 countries; the approach complements campus and healthcare partnerships. Centralized procurement drives compliance and cost control, supporting the company that reported $16.2 billion revenue in 2023. Category management standardizes menus and specs; robust contingency planning preserves continuity during disruptions.

    Icon

    Digital ordering and service platforms

    Digital ordering and service platforms at Aramark use mobile apps, kiosks, and web portals to streamline ordering and payments while delivering real-time menus, nutrition data, and queue insights to improve access and speed of service.

    Multi-venue and event coverage

    Aramark deploys flexible staffing across stadiums, arenas and special events, scaling teams to match demand and supporting pop-up stations that expand capacity during peak periods. Portable equipment and standardized kits cut setup time; a central command center coordinates inventory and replenishment across venues, supporting Aramark’s ~17.6 billion USD FY2024 revenue footprint.
